We are in the midst of a flurry of efforts to reform our malpractice system. More than half of the states have enacted limits on the amount of money that juries can award someone who has been injured by a doctor, and Congress is considering a federal cap of two hundred and fifty thousand dollars on non-economic damage awards. But none of this will make the system fairer or less frustrating for either doctors or patients. It simply puts an arbitrary limit on payments so that doctors' insurance premiums might, at least temporarily, be more affordable. Tracey Nursing Instructor, Certified Nurse Educ The main problem stems from that fact that medical mistake reporting usually is quantified as a total number of adverse events instead of by the patients underlying condition. In other words, many hospital mistakes are never reported because they do not qualify as a clear-cut adverse event where a bad medical action caused a specific injury. Many errors, however, do not cause a specific injury but instead lead to a worsening of condition. NEW YORK LEGAL MALPRACTICE 4 Authority: In an action to recover damages for legal malpractice, a plaintiff must demonstrate that the attorney 'failed to exercise the ordinary reasonable skill and knowledge commonly possessed by a member of the legal profession' citation omitted. Rudolf v. Shayne, Dachs, Stanisci, Corker & Sauer, 8 N.Y.3d 438, 442, 867 N.E.2d 385, 387, 835 N.Y.S.2d 534, 536 (2007). 2.1.2. Ethical Violation/Violation of Disciplinary Rules Rule: An ethical violation or violation of a disciplinary rule alone does not give rise to a cause of action in legal malpractice. Authority: An ethical violation will not, in and of itself, create a duty that gives rise to a cause of action that would otherwise not exist at law (see, Drago v. Buonagurio, 46 NY2d 778, 779-780 'the courts have not recognized any liability of the lawyer to third parties (based on an ethical violation) where the factual situations have not fallen within one of the acknowledged categories of tort or contract liability'). Shapiro v. McNeill, 92 N.Y.2d 91, 97, 699 N.E.2d 407, 677 N.Y.S.2d 48 (1998). 2.2. Proximate Cause 2.2.1. But For Causation Rule: In order to establish the element of proximate cause, the plaintiff in a legal malpractice action must demonstrate that he/she would have prevailed or had a better result on the underlying matter but for the attorney's negligence. Authority: To establish causation, a plaintiff must show that he or she would have prevailed in the underlying action or would not have incurred any damages, but for the lawyer's negligence. Rudolf v. Shayne, Dachs, Stanisci, Corker & Sauer, 8 N.Y.3d 438, 442, 867 N.E.2d 385, 387, 835 N.Y.S.2d 534, 536 (2007). Proximate cause requires a showing that 'but for' the attorney's negligence, the plaintiff would either have been successful in the underlying matter or would not have sustained any ascertainable damages citation omitted. Barbara King Family Trust v. Voluto Ventures LLC, 46 A.D.3d 423, 424, 849 N.Y.S.2d 41 (1st Dep't 2007). Klearman Jan 26, 2010 2 comments More recently, the Supreme Court for the first time placed limits on states' imposition of punitive damage awards. In BMW of North America, Inc. v. Gore (1996), an owner of a BMW was apprised nearly a year after his purchase that the car had been repainted before it ever arrived at the showroom. Such a repainting was considered by BMW to be a minor repair, costing less than 3 percent of the car's overall value ($40,000). Nonetheless, had such a repainting been disclosed, the market value of the car would have been 10 percent less. Dr. Gore, the owner, argued (successfully) that he was entitled to $4,000 compensatory damages (the amount he paid in excess of the market value of the car). Dr. Gore's attorney argued that BMW of North America had systematically been defrauding customers in its failure to disclose such repairs. BMW argued that such no state specifically required disclosure unless the repairs exceeded 3 percent of the car's value; the Alabama jury, however, sought to punish BMW for its actions in the U.S. market by imposing a punitive damages award that was 1,000 times the compensatory award of $4,000.

Read More The first step for the solicitor will be to obtain the medical records detailing all the treatment that has been provided to you. Your solicitor will then instruct a medical expert to look at your case. They will look through your medical records and may also meet and examine you. The expert will then produce a formal report setting out their view on the treatment you have received and whether there has been any negligence.
